click tracking


Multilingual Native English Teacher

Originally from San Francisco, I've went to college at Tulane University in New Orleans, worked for the Brazilian government in Washington, and worked and earned a master's degree in Geneva, Switzerland. I've also lived in Brasília and São Paulo, Brazil. Along the way, I've helped countless students improve their English and sound more like natives. When choosing an English as a Second Language teacher, there is always a trade-off between the incomparable idiomatic repertoire of native spe...